Capacity note on versioning for the Swanmere shared component library — welcome aboard, new folks! Every minor release keeps the last few versions warm on the CDN, and each one costs us cache space plus a build-matrix slot. Historically we've been sloppy about retiring old majors, and the Copperfen dashboard shows storage creeping up about 6% a month. So we're formalizing limits: how many versions stay published, how long deprecations linger, and how often the pruner runs. The agreed constants are below.

tuning constants:
QUOTAS = {
    "quenael": 10,
    "oliwyn": 1,
}

MEMO — Board Distribution Only

Quick update on the Brindle Tools divestiture: we've narrowed the field to two bidders, both strategic buyers, and Rowenna's team expects final offers within three weeks. Valuation is tracking a touch above our floor, which is a pleasant surprise given the soft market. Employee comms are drafted but embargoed until signing. One bidder wants the Ferndale warehouse included; we're resisting. The confidential piece on what comes next sits below.

board note of fafog-yahap: Project Rusdor slips by a full year because of the audit delay.

## Tax-Rate Lookup Cache

The Levyline cache fronts the tax-rate lookup service and must be warmed before each release cut. Release managers should run the warm-up job at least two hours prior to deploy; stale entries expire after 24 hours, and a cold cache will cause checkout latency spikes in the first region to receive traffic. The warm-up job authenticates to the Levyline internal endpoint with the key below.

service key, fajeg-yadup: qvz23-2K74erq9AL1Oz4AxxOHshcN

Reseller Programme — Manager Briefing (restricted)

Heads up, branch managers: the Kestrelline reseller programme goes live next month. Partners get tiered discounts tied to quarterly volume, plus co-branded demo kits. Don't promise margins beyond the published bands — central will claw those back. Training packs land next week. Where this fits in the bigger picture is outlined below.

confidential, kagup-bafog: Fraaxax Group is in early talks to buy Soroxox Group for about $343.8 million. The Olidor launch date is June 14, and nothing goes to the press before then. Legal wants the Aldmirek Logistics term sheet signed before July 23.